The rumors about the death of Indiana basketball have been greatly exaggerated, we think.  For the first time in over a year, the Hoosiers are on a three-game winning streak against high-major competition. Indiana started fast with an 8-0 run to open the game.  They did fall behind 23-18, but closed the first half on a 12-2 run.  After trading baskets to open the second, the Hoosiers pulled away in convincing fashion.  A 26-12 stretch over 10 minutes of the second half proved decisive. Hours before Indiana took the court in Minneapolis on Wednesday evening, the news broke coach Mike Woodson will be returning for the 2024-25 season to lead the program for a fourth year. Woodson led the Hoosiers to a third straight win, a 70-58 triumph over Minnesota at Williams Arena. The soon to be 66 Woodson was in no mood to talk about his job status following the game. Mike Woodson’s future as the IU basketball coach has been a popular topic in recent weeks.  But the speculation came to an end Wednesday evening. He’ll be back for the 2024-25 season, The Daily Hoosier can confirm via sources. Zach Osterman of the Indy Star appeared to be the first to report the news.  Well known national reporters Jon Rothstein and Jeff Goodman also reported Woodson’s return. Woodson is 60-39 in three seasons at Indiana, including a 29-29 record in the Big Ten. The 65 year-old led IU to the NCAA Tournament each of his first two season in Bloomington. …

Indiana is headed to the Big Ten Tournament in Minneapolis with a lot of uncertainty. Not the least of which is who the Hoosiers will face when they open action on Friday evening at the Target Center. The No. 3 seed, Indiana could face any of Rutgers, Minnesota or Michigan depending on how things play out on Wednesday and Thursday. IU also doesn’t know for sure who will be available to play when they take the floor Friday. After he suffered a wrist injury in January of his lone season in Bloomington, Indiana never got the best of Eric Gordon’s sustained prowess as a long range shooter. He’s left no doubt in the NBA. Indiana appeared to be on their way towards a long afternoon at College Park on Sunday.  They fell behind by 10 at halftime and by as much as 16 early in the second half.  And then it happened.  In what was their best basketball of the entire season, the Hoosiers turned a 51-35 second half deficit into a 75-64 lead — a 40-13 run on the road — in the span of about 14 minutes. IU women’s basketball’s path to a Big Ten Tournament title is now clear. Indiana will open tournament action on Friday evening in Minneapolis at around 9 p.m. ET against either Michigan, Minnesota or Rutgers. If the Hoosiers advance to the weekend, they’ll likely face Iowa for a third time this season.  That game would be on Saturday afternoon at around 4:30 p.m. ET. The championship game is Sunday at Noon ET on CBS. The full bracket is below.
